KBE Partners launches to power SMEs with expert support for everything people, brand and business growth

KBE Partners, a dynamic new business support agency, has officially launched to empower small and medium-sized businesses with expert guidance and flexible support for everything people, brand and business growth.

Small and medium-sized businesses often miss out on the kind of senior strategic support that fuels real growth. KBE Partners, a newly launched and innovative business support agency, aims to change that. Founded by three senior professionals with decades of experience across HR, leadership, branding, marketing, communications, operations and more; KBE Partners helps growing businesses access the kind of strategic thinking, delivery expertise and trusted support usually reserved for big corporates — but in a way that’s practical, flexible and tailored for SMEs. The agency offers flexible, tailored guidance across everything people, brand and business growth.

Smart, scalable support for every stage of growth

The KBE founding team has worked on both sides of the fence: in fast-paced corporate roles, and inside growing SME businesses that are looking to scale sustainably. By bringing together best practice from big business, with the energy, agility and heart that makes small businesses thrive; KBE Partners offers practical and flexible support, working in partnership with SME leaders to help them navigate growth, change, and opportunity.

Flexible support, tailored to SMEs

KBE Partners is proud to offer SME business owners access to a comprehensive menu of services across everything people, brand and business growth. Whether it’s staying compliant and confident on HR matters, building a brand that stands out and connects, or unlocking new, sustainable growth opportunities, they are on hand to help business owners overcome everyday challenges and move towards their vision.

Unlike traditional agencies or one-off consultants, the KBE model is integrated and adaptable, giving SMEs access to a bespoke programme of expert support to springboard business growth. Their agile range of packages is designed with real businesses in mind, giving customers the freedom to adjust support in line with evolving business needs. This flexible approach guarantees value for business owners, while offering them the flexibility to swap between service areas, scale hours up or down, and even roll over any unused time each month.
